New Art Show at CVUU!

The works of artist Orgia “Gia” Labidi are featured in our foyer gallery for April’s “Some Say” Exhibition.
Gia is an award-winning, self-taught artist influenced by her African and Native American heritage and sense of the divine feminine. Working in various visual mediums, including clay, wood, paper, … read more.
